The Dodge P56040325AD 02 Ram Van 3500 5.9L Engine Control Module Unit (ECU) is a crucial component of your vehicle's powertrain control system. This Electronic Control Unit, also known as the Powertrain Control Module (PCM), is responsible for managing and coordinating various engine functions to ensure optimal performance and fuel efficiency.
This specific ECU model, P56040325AD, is designed for use in 2002 Dodge Ram Van 3500 vehicles equipped with the 5.9L engine. It comes as a replacement for the original unit that may have failed due to wear and tear or engine damage.
The ECU plays a vital role in controlling the engine's ignition system, fuel injection, and emissions systems. It processes input data from various sensors and actuators to adjust engine parameters and maintain stable operating conditions. The unit also communicates with other vehicle systems, such as the transmission control module and the anti-lock braking system, to ensure seamless integration and operation.
This high-precision ECU features advanced programming capabilities, enabling it to adapt to changing driving conditions and optimize engine performance. It also includes built-in diagnostic functions that can help identify potential issues before they become major problems, ensuring your vehicle remains reliable and efficient.
